THREAD: U.S. banks shaved nearly $21 billion from their tax bills last year — almost double the IRS's annual budget — thanks to Trump's tax cuts.

But while the cuts payed out well for shareholders, the banks cut thousands of jobs and slowed lending #tictocnews
MORE: By the end of 2018, most of the nation's biggest lenders met or exceeded their predictions for tax savings.

On average, the banks saw their effective tax rates drop from 28% in 2016 to 19% in 2018 #tictocnews
MORE: The banks vowed to use their tax savings to give back to employees, but the 23 biggest banks eliminated nearly 4,300 jobs #tictocnews

JUST IN: The U.S. has charged a Russian national for conspiracy to interfere in elections
MORE: The woman, identified as Elena Alekseevna Khusyaynova of St. Petersburg, was allegedly the chief accountant for "Project Lakhta," according to the Justice Department #tictocnews
MORE: Project Lakhta's efforts included the creation of thousands of social media and email accounts that waged "information war warfare against the United States" #tictocnews

THREAD⬇️ After Britain voted for Brexit, big banks made plans to relocate thousands of their U.K.-based jobs to new hubs inside the EU. We tracked the jobs the banks say they plan to move bloom.bg/2GA7J5j #tictocnews
UBS could be moving 1,500 of it’s 5000 UK-based jobs to Frankfurt, Madrid, and likely elsewhere bloom.bg/2GA7J5j
Goldman Sachs might relocate 1,000 of it’s 6,000 U.K.-based jobs to Frankfurt bloom.bg/2GA7J5j
